My Card


Recipe
Spellbinders - Radiant Rectangles
Opulent Ovals
Parisian Accents
Standard Circles
Couture Creations - Tied Together Embossing Folder
Little Claire - Sentiment Stamp
Pennies Worth - Blue pearlescent cardstock
Offray Ribbon
Pearls from stash


I started by making a 5" x 7" tent fold card. And then just layered up the various diecuts as you can see.  I added some pale blue and white pearls and cut up a pearly spray. I added a flower pearl to the bow and that was it.  The bow looks a bit odd but that's because I realise I have cropped the image too much and chopped off part of the bow.
